At 05:07 AM 11/12/2001, Peter-Paul Koch wrote:

>As far as I can see it can look OK-ish in NN4 if you put the image outside 
>the P. An image inside a P with a line-height fouls up mightily in NN4, if 
>you put it outside the P it will probably look much better.
>
>If you redefine
>
>border-bottom: 4px solid #000066;
>
>as
>
>border-bottom-width: 4px;
>border-style: solid;
>border-bottom-color: #000066;

+1 - thanks very much for that - it's now fully legible in NS 4.7 on Win 
(though it still doesn't look pretty)

In response to Erik Mattheis's (very valid) skepticism re: using CSS when 
the same layout could easily be achieved with tables: I generally use 
tables for layout in order to make it work for NS 4.x users, but in this 
case I decided not to for a few reasons:

1. I'm not anticipating a huge number of visitors - when we have our first 
Top 40 hit and the site gets swamped, maybe I'll switch to tables - in the 
meantime, if 6 people in the next year don't see the formatting properly, I 
can accept that
2. it's a personal site, to some extent, so I don't have to satisfy anyone 
else's requirements
3. it gave me a chance to start learning CSS-based layout
4. it feels so good to use the right technology

As long as the information is actually accessible to users of older 
browsers, I'm satisfied.
